finally got to audition the sr-l700 today and compare it to the sr-009 from the same rig. the sr-l700 had a more forward presentation as i heard it, with upper mids and treble accentuated more than the sr-009. both exhibited the clarity and resolution for which estats are renowned. i also found the hd800s to be a worthy alternative option.
the amp was the srm-007t. i'm not sure which dac was used. the cma600i was used for the hd800s and other dynamic/planar magnetic cans that i auditioned so it might have been its dac.
and yes, i was referring to both the sr-l700 and sr-009. i hasten to add that all of the usual caveats apply.
